Ingredients of Crockpot BBQ Ribs by Donna

  1. It's 2 1/2 lb of boneless pork backribs.
  2. Prepare 2 cup of ketchup.
  3. Prepare 1/3 cup of Worcestershire sauce.
  4. Prepare 1/2 tsp of salt.
  5. Prepare 1/2 tsp of garlic pepper.
  6. You need 1 tbsp of lemon juice.
  7. Prepare 1 tsp of chili powder.
  8. Prepare 2 cup of water.
  9. You need 1 dash of crushed red pepper.

Crockpot BBQ Ribs by Donna step by step

  1. Spray crockpot with cooking spray..
  2. Place ribs in crockpot..
  3. Mix all ingredients in large bowl..
  4. Pour over ribs..
  5. Depending on your time, cook as desired..
  6. I cooked mine on high for about 2 hours then low for the remainder of the evening..
